Abstract

This manual provides practical information on all major disease vectors and pests: mosquitos and other biting Diptera, tsetse flies, triatomine bugs, bedbugs, fleas, lice, ticks, mites, cockroaches, houseflies, water fleas and freshwater snails. For each group of vectors, information is provided on biology, public health importance and control measures. Chapters on house-spraying with residual insecticides and the safe use of pesticides are also included. It is intended for use by health workers and auxiliary staff working with people at district and community level, as well as for health planners, aid organizations and those working in refugee camps.
